101st annual Christian County Agricultural Fair
TAYLORVILLE — Christian County’s 101st Agricultural Fair is finally here. Opening up with a ribbon cutting ceremony on Tuesday morning, July 15, the fair will surely bring action and excitement with it’s events, extravagance and excellence with it’s farm shows as well as mouth watering indulgence with it’s variety of food. Throughout this week there will be rides, displays and even a full Clay Walker concert.
“It’s a great opportunity to bring the public together, to work together to see what’s showcasing one of the biggest industries in the County,” Christian County Board Chairman Bryan Sharp exclaims. “A really nice opportunity. A lot of equipment manufacturers are represented here, local businesses represented here. It’s a great opportunity. A lot of great events that they’ve done this year so we look forward to seeing them but it’s just a great opportunity to come out and interact with one another. Things we really need to get back to as a community.”
